ORDER adopting in its entirety 24 Report and Recommendations, and plaintiff's complaint is dismissed without prejudice; further the previously issued 21 REPORT AND RECOMMENDATIONS and plaintiff's 19 MOTION to Dismiss Party filed by Brady Lee Horton are terminated as moot. Signed by Honorable Paul K. Holmes, III on June 22, 2011. (rw)
